We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Customer Service Trainer to join our team. The ideal candidate will be passionate about customer service excellence and have a proven track record in training and developing customer service professionals. You will play a key role in enhancing our customer service operations by delivering high-quality training programs that empower our team to provide exceptional service.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and deliver comprehensive training programs for new and existing customer service representatives
  • Conduct needs assessments to identify training requirements and gaps
  • Create engaging training materials, including manuals, e-learning modules, and workshops
  • Facilitate classroom and virtual training sessions, ensuring content is delivered effectively
  • Evaluate the effectiveness of training programs through assessments, feedback, and performance metrics
  • Provide ongoing coaching and support to customer service representatives to enhance their skills and performance
  • Collaborate with the customer service management team to align training initiatives with business objectives
  • Stay up-to-date with industry trends and best practices in customer service and training methodologies
  • Maintain accurate records of training activities and participant progress

Experience:

  • You’ll have a proven track record of successfully delivering effective training within a corporate organisation.
  • A strong customer service background will be essential to understand the department's challenges.
  • You’ll have a strong knowledge of customer service principles and practices
  • Excellent presentation and facilitation skills
  • Proficiency in creating and delivering e-learning content
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ills
  • You’ll have the ability to assess training needs and develop customized training solutions
  • Experience with training evaluation and metrics

How to prepare for a job interview at Shred-it

✨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, dive deep into the company’s mission and values. Understand their approach to customer service and how they train their staff. This will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also show your genuine interest in the role.

✨Showcase Your Training Skills

Prepare to discuss specific training programmes you've developed or delivered in the past. Bring examples of training materials you've created, like manuals or e-learning modules, and be ready to explain how they improved customer service outcomes.

✨Engage with Real Scenarios

Think of real-life customer service challenges you've faced and how you addressed them. Be prepared to share these experiences during the interview, as they demonstrate your problem-solving skills and ability to coach others through similar situations.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t shy away from asking questions about their current training initiatives or how they measure success in customer service. This shows that you’re proactive and genuinely interested in contributing to their goals.
